#4 Tables and Tickers

All Financial Papers have a table showing the shares traded along with a few columns besides them. The image here is self explanatory. More often than not, the newpaper will carry a small header/footer explaining the relevant details. The most important ones are Open, High, Low, Close, Volume.

Apart from all these they also carry one term called P/E ratio. This is the foundation for the understanding of the stock markets. I have omitted this one because I have not dealt with this topic yet.

The TV channels show a strip, which shows the last traded price during the market hours, delayed by a few minutes(usually 2-15 minutes). In the off market hours, They show the last closing price of the stock.
